We moved to event based packaging and all the original events are available in the UE4 editor, but any new ones I add are not showing up. Even after I generate sound data. Am I missing something?

Hi Dave,

Tried "Clear Sound Data" or "Force Asset Synchronization"? If that doesn't work, maybe try deleting your Wwise Audio folder and Generate Sound Data again.

Let us know if it works
